What a wonderful museum! I love small niche museums and this one is great. Architecturally significant for its Art Nouveau design. There is a great collection of enamels; things like teaspoons, decorative items, other tableware. There is some furniture from the era. And the front entrance is a former pharmacy with all the drawers. And be sure to look for the owls

This lovely Art Noveau museum collection is housed in an old Art Noveau pharmacy building that is equally lovely. The admission price includes use of the lockers, which was a welcome way to leave raincoats and backpacks behind for a while. A tunnel connects to the KUBE. Admission also includes the Fishing Museum, about a 10-minute walk away.
